as an expat you will be treated a bit better than the turkish guys, especially regarding rostering (5 block off-days, in total and average you will have more than 8 days off per month which is not the case for turkish pilots)

the conditions depend highly on the fleet you will join. you'll find the best conditions of course in the wide body fleets (B777/787 and A350), followed by A330, thereafter A320 and last & least B737 (a lot of legs and considerably less total salary plus bad destinations plus a lot of AJET flights)

In the last years (except during the pandemic days) in average (including all extra payments like bonuses, profit share etc)
- a F/O earns 5500 € net (narrow body) / 7000 € net (wide body) approximately
- a CPT 8500 € net (narrow) / 10500 € net (wide body and instructors)
these average payments didn't change much or even decreased a little bit in the last years

atmosphere is friendly, salary is not bad, you'll be fine against the inflation, the location is close to europe and there are more than 1 flight to most destinations. moreover istanbul is a huge city with lots of opportunities for social life. If you are looking to build hours, I recommend. B737 fleet has too many sectors unfortunately. We are expecting it will be better for good in 1.5 years when AJET operations are over. Also you'll have widebody upgrade opportunity even if you start at Narrow Body
